ASSURANCES <br />The Grant Applicant, by signing the coversheet to the application submitted to the State, certifies they <br />have read all application documents including these assurances, any revised documents, and agrees to <br />comply with the approved application materials and all federal, state, and local laws, ordinances, rules <br />and regulations, public policies herein and all others as applicable. <br />1. Survival of Terms <br />The following clauses below survive the expiration or cancellation of this award:5b) Audits; 6) Liability; <br />7) Intellectual Property Rights; 8) Publicity and Endorsement; 9) Government Data Practices; 10) Data <br />Disclosure; and 12) Governing Law, Jurisdiction and Venue. <br />2. Use of Funds <br />The use of funds shall be limited to that portion identified in the application materials and the attached <br />application and by any applicable state or federal laws. Funds should support the purpose and activities <br />approved in the application. <br />a. The Grantee, in the conduct of activities under this award, shall submit such reports as may be <br />required by written instructions of the State within the times required by it. The State reserves the <br />right to withhold funding if reporting requirements are not met. The Grantee must promptly return <br />to the State any unexpended funds not accounted for in the financial report due to the State at <br />grant closeout. <br />b. The Grantee shall present reports to the State or the State’s Authorized Representative. At the <br />Commissioner’s discretion, these reports may be presented at departmental, legislative, other state <br />agency or public meetings where the Grantee shall be available to explain the project and respond <br />to questions. <br />c.Reimbursement for travel and subsistence expenses actually and necessarily incurred by Grantee in <br />performance of this project will be paid if State is allowed in the approved budget, provided that <br />the Grantee shall be reimbursed for travel and subsistence expenses in the same manner and in no <br />greater amount than in the current “Commissioner’s Plan,” promulgated by the Commissioner of <br />Minnesota Management and Budget (MMB). The Grantee will only be reimbursed for travel and <br />subsistence outside Minnesota if it has received prior written approval for such out-of-state travel <br />from the STATE. The current Commissioner’s Plan can be viewed to obtain current maximum <br />expense reimbursement rates (https://mn.gov/mmb/employee-relations/labor- <br />relations/labor/commissioners-plan.jsp). <br />108
